Unable to delete a private channel
Hi I seem to be unable to delete a private channel after having created a private channel for testing. The channel has no content and only one additional user, that was added after I found that...

Hi,
Our Tenant has a retention policy enabled for Sharepoint, so it is not possible to delete a private channel from a Teams.
I tested it by removing the private channel site from the retention policy and was able to delete it from Teams.
Therefore, if the retention policy is enabled for Sharepoint, you cannot delete a private channel without first removing it from retention.

josegfl hi Jose, how did you exclude teams site collection from the sharepoint Lists configured for a retention policy?
Thanks
- josegflMar 23, 2020Copper Contributor
- https://protection.office.com/retention
- Select a policy and Edit Policy
- Locations applied
- SharePointSites ---> Exclude sites and Exclude sites
- Type URL site and Exclude e Done (Save)
https://sharepointmaven.com/how-to-set-a-retention-policy-on-a-sharepoint-site/
- Jeff_ParkerMar 31, 2020Brass ContributorThis worked thanks. It took a bit of time (approx. 30 mins) after excluding the site before I could delete the private channel.
